Mu'azu Will Be Back Soon After Medical Trip Abroad – Aide

Source: thewillnigeria.com

SAN FRANCISCO, May 12, (THEWILL) – The Chief Press Secretary to the Dr. Adamu Mu'azu, the National Chairman of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Chief Tony Amadi, Tuesday, said the party's national chairman, is currently undergoing medical attention abroad and will return to the country as soon as his doctors are satisfied with his medical condition.

Amadi, in a statement issued in Abuja, said “He left the country last week and hopes to be back soon.”

According to Amadi, “The leader of the party, President Goodluck Jonathan, the Chairman of the Board of Trustees of the party, Chief Tony Anenih and Senate President, Senator David Mark, and members of the National Working Committee of the party are all aware of the Chairman’s medical trip abroad.”

He also conveyed Mu'azu's appeal to the party's faithful to be patient , assuring that the travails facing the party will soon wither away and the party will be a united opposition to the incoming All Progressive Congress (APC) for the overall good of Nigeria.
